The countdown is on for Prince William and Kate Middleton‘s highly anticipated royal wedding. The invitations have been mailed out for the Friday, April 29 event.
Of course, everybody is talking about the wedding dress and who the designer will be.
“This is being treated as a state secret; it really is being shrouded in secrecy,” says Katie. “[Kate’s] determined to keep the wedding dress a secret. When she leaves the Goring Hotel, she’s having a marquee specially created over the entrance so that no one will get a glimpse of her until she enters Westminster Abbey.”
Approximately 1,900 invitations were sent out last week. Among the guests are over 1,000 of Prince William and Miss Middleton’s family and friends; over 50 Members of the royal family; over 40 members of foreign royal families; over 200 members of government, parliament and diplomatic corps; approximately 80 guests drawn from Prince William’s charities; 60 governors-general and realm prime ministers; and 30 Members of the defence services.
“The wedding is being split into two parts,” says Katie. “The majority of the people at this wedding are going to be friends of the couple. … It’s not a state wedding. This really is a wedding for their family and friends.”
Following the wedding, approximately 600 people have been invited to the lunchtime reception at Buckingham Palace given by The Queen, and around 300 people have been invited to the dinner at Buckingham Palace given by The Prince of Wales.
